摘要
介绍一种同步电机自控变频调速控制方案.同步电机的自控变频是利用角位置码盘检测电机的转速和转角,并将码盘产生的一组方波信号经过Walsh变换转换成正弦信号去控制电枢电压而实现的,控制线路简单,精度高。
A speed control scheme for self-controlled synchronous motors are presented .A sine signal to control the armature current of a synchronous motor is obtained by applying the Walsh transform to a square ware , generated by measureing the anqular displacement of the synchronous motor with a code disc . Simplicity of the control circuit and high precision are among some merits of this scheme .
